当前位置:   article > 正文

阿里云企业级 Kubernetes 部署方案详解

阿里云企业级 Kubernetes 部署方案详解

Kubernetes 已成为云原生应用部署和管理的行业标准。阿里云作为国内领先的云计算服务提供商,提供了全面的企业级 Kubernetes 部署方案,帮助企业高效、安全地运行 Kubernetes 集群。本文将深入探讨阿里云企业级 Kubernetes 部署方案的具体操作流程。

方案概述

阿里云企业级 Kubernetes 部署方案基于阿里云弹性容器服务(ACK),提供以下核心特性:

  • **高可用性:**采用多可用区部署,确保集群在故障情况下仍能正常运行。
  • **弹性伸缩:**根据业务需求自动调整节点数量,优化资源利用率。
  • **安全隔离:**通过虚拟私有云(VPC)和安全组,实现集群与其他资源的隔离。
  • **监控告警:**提供全面的监控和告警机制,及时发现和处理异常情况。
  • **运维管理:**提供统一的运维管理平台,简化集群运维操作。

操作流程

1. 创建集群

  • 登录阿里云控制台,进入 ACK 界面。
  • 选择创建集群,配置集群名称、地域、可用区等参数。
  • 选择节点类型、节点数量等资源配置。
  • 设置网络配置,包括 VPC、子网、安全组等。

2. 安装 Kubectl

  • 下载并安装 Kubectl 工具,用于与 Kubernetes 集群交互。
  • 配置 Kubectl,连接到阿里云 Kubernetes 集群。

3. 部署应用

  • 创建 Kubernetes 部署文件,定义应用的镜像、副本数等信息。
  • 使用 Kubectl 命令,将部署文件应用到集群中。
  • 验证应用是否正常运行。

4. 配置监控告警

  • 在 ACK 控制台,配置监控和告警规则。
  • 设置告警触发条件、通知方式等信息。
  • 确保重要指标和事件都能得到及时监控和告警。

5. 运维管理

  • 使用 ACK 运维管理平台,进行集群监控、节点管理、日志查询等操作。
  • 定期进行集群更新和维护,确保集群稳定运行。
  • 结合阿里云其他云服务,如弹性伸缩、负载均衡等,实现更高级别的运维自动化。

最佳实践

  • 采用高可用部署架构,避免单点故障。
  • 根据业务需求,合理配置节点资源和副本数。
  • 使用命名空间和标签,对应用和资源进行隔离和管理。
  • 定期进行集群备份,确保数据安全。
  • 遵循 Kubernetes 最佳实践,优化应用性能和稳定性。

总结
通过遵循本文介绍的操作流程,企业可以快速搭建稳定可靠的 Kubernetes 环境,充分发挥 Kubernetes 的优势,加速云原生应用的落地。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/从前慢现在也慢/article/detail/288027
推荐阅读
相关标签
  

闽ICP备14008679号